Ather Energy has started accepting bookings for its upcoming electric scooter, the Rizta. Set to be unveiled on April 6th, the new Ather Rizta is now open for bookings at a nominal booking amount of Rs 999 across all the Ather Energy dealerships and the official website.  The Ather Rizta will lock horns with Ola S1, TVS iQube, Bajaj Chetak and others in the electric scooter segment. 

The upcoming Ather Rizta electric scooter has already been spied a few times in fully camouflaged form, with a few of its details confirmed through these sightings. Going by its outline, the new Ather Rizta will be positioned as a family-oriented unisex scooter with more practicality compared to the brand’s current offering, the 450 lineup. 

A few of the features of the Ather Rizta, which are now confirmed to be offered in its, include an apron-mounted LED headlamp, all-LED turn indicators and tail lamp, a full-TFT touchscreen instrument console with Bluetooth connectivity and navigation. It will also get a segment-first anti-skid feature, which is rumoured to have similar functionality as a conventional dual-channel ABS.

While the technical specifications of the Ather Rizta are still under wraps, in all likelihood, it will share its battery and motor setup with the Ather 450S and 450X. With the new Rizta, Ather Energy is expected to strengthen its position in the market and rivalry against other scooters like Ola S1, TVS iQube, Ampere Primus and Bajaj Chetak.
